The Arctic EIA project worked under the auspices of the Arctic Council and its Sustainable Development Working Group.The aim of the project was to improve the application of environmental impact assessments (EIA) in the Arctic region. The project gathered examples of existing good practices across the Arctic, identified areas where improvements are needed and formulated associated recommendations. These recommendations and good practice examples are being shared here with proponents, authorities, consultants, other stakeholders and the public to raise awareness, while relying on the Arctic states’ governments to enhance their application
